Original Description
Jean Baptiste Olive's Entree Du Port Marchand is a luminous example of late 19th-century French marine painting, capturing the bustling energy of a Mediterranean trading port bathed in golden sunlight. Olive masterfully blends realism with Impressionist touches, rendering the rippling harbor waters with fluid brushwork while meticulously detailing fishing boats, sail clusters, and sun-bleached architecture. As a Marseille-born artist, Olive authentically depicts Provençal maritime life during France's industrial boom when ports like this thrived commercially. Though less radical than Monet's harborscapes, this work exemplifies the transitional moment when academic precision embraced atmospheric spontaneity. Its historical significance lies in documenting regional economic vitality through an artistic lens – neither purely documentary nor fully avant-garde, but harmoniously balanced.
